What Causes Storm Damage in South Jersey & Philadelphia
Nor'easters
Sustained wind and heavy rain from Nor'easters are one of the region's most common sources of roof and window damage.
Summer Thunderstorms
Fast-moving severe storms can bring damaging wind gusts and hail with very little warning.
Falling Trees & Limbs
Mature tree canopy in older Camden County neighborhoods means storm winds regularly bring down limbs onto roofs and siding.
Flash Flooding
Low-lying areas near the Delaware River and its tributaries are prone to fast flooding during heavy rain events.
Ice & Snow Load
Heavy, wet snow and ice buildup can stress roofs and gutters during winter storms.
Power Outages
Extended outages during major storms can lead to sump pump failure and secondary water damage.
Our Storm Damage Process
Emergency Response & Tarping
We secure the property first — tarping roofs, boarding windows, and stopping ongoing exposure.
Damage Assessment & Documentation
A full walkthrough documents every affected area for your insurance claim.
Water Extraction & Drying
If flooding was involved, we extract water and dry the structure the same way we would any water loss.
Debris & Damaged Material Removal
Damaged roofing, siding, and other materials are removed and disposed of.
Full Repair & Reconstruction
We rebuild what the storm took, from roofing down to interior finishes.
